Davis Refinery to bring jobs, revenue to Billings County

Published: Sep 08 2017
Davis Refinery to bring jobs, revenue to Billings County - Photo
BELFIELD—The proposed Davis Refinery has drawn ire from environmental groups who object to its close proximity to the borders of Theodore Roosevelt National Park. As the North Dakota Department of Health scrutinizes the refinery's permit application, William Prentice, CEO of Meridian Energy Group, spoke about why this refinery is going to be a "good neighbor" to the people of Billings County.

"The local community wants the refinery there," Prentice said in a phone interview. "We've conclusively demonstrated that the refinery cannot be seen from the park. We're having a hard time understanding the resistance...especially when the local community is behind the project."

Prentice estimates that the Billings' annual tax revenues will nearly triple when the refinery is open.
